Gingerbread Pudding
(Serves 8)
Ingredients:
3 cups Applesauce 1 package (13 oz.) Gingerbread Mix (include the ingredients for the mix per instructions)
Directions:
Pour the applesauce into a previously oiled Dutch Oven.
Cover and heat until bubbly.
Prepare gingerbread batter per instructions.
Pour batter over hot applesauce.
Cover and bake approximately 30 minutes or until gingerbread topping is done.
